Understanding Seals and Their Functions
Seals are designed to prevent the passage of fluids or gases between 2 elements. They work by producing a barrier that reduces leak, secures equipment against contamination, and assists preserve correct pressure levels. Here's a table summing up the typical kinds of seals:
Type of SealMaterial UsedMain ApplicationsO-RingRubber, SiliconeHydraulic systems, pumpsGasketCork, FiberglassFlange connections, pipingLip SealRubber, PlasticTurning shafts, axlesMechanical SealCarbon, CeramicPumps, compressors, turning equipmentBonded SealNumerous substancesAerospace, vehicle, commercialTypical Seal Issues

When attending to seal issues, there are a few repair techniques that can be utilized depending on the level of the damage.
1. Replacing the Seal
This is the most uncomplicated option when a seal is beyond repair. Replacement involves removing the harmed seal and fitting a new one, making sure appropriate installation.
2. Reconditioning the Seal
Sometimes, seals can be refurbished. This may involve cleansing and smoothing surfaces and using sealant products to fill minor spaces or cracks.
3. Using Sealants
Specialized sealants can be used to seal minor leakages. It is essential to choose a sealant that works with the products being sealed and Weather Seal Replacement the environment it will be exposed to.
4. Retrofitting
For installation where seals are vulnerable to failure, retrofitting with a more robust seal style can improve durability and dependability.
5. Surface area Adjustment
Ensuring that the breeding surface areas are smooth and devoid of particles can improve seal effectiveness. This might involve machining or sanding surfaces as necessary.
